
EXCEL中生成与户主关系
在Excel中生成与户主关系的过程可以通过公式、数据验证、VLOOKUP函数、数据透视表等多种方法来实现。我们将详细讲解其中的一些步骤,并提供一些专业的建议。
一、使用公式生成与户主关系
在Excel中,我们可以通过公式来生成与户主的关系。使用公式的优势在于自动化程度高,能快速生成所需结果。
1、使用IF公式
IF公式是一种常见且强大的工具,可以根据特定条件生成与户主关系。例如,如果A列是户主姓名,B列是家庭成员姓名,那么我们可以在C列使用以下公式来生成与户主的关系:
=IF(A2=B2, "户主", "家庭成员")
这个公式的含义是:如果A列的值等于B列的值,那么C列显示“户主”;否则显示“家庭成员”。
2、使用VLOOKUP函数
VLOOKUP函数可以用于查找和匹配数据。假设我们有一个包含所有家庭成员和户主的表格,我们可以使用VLOOKUP来生成与户主的关系。
例如,假设A列是家庭成员姓名,B列是户主姓名,我们可以在C列使用以下公式:
=IF(VLOOKUP(A2, $A$2:$B$10, 2, FALSE)=A2, "户主", "家庭成员")
该公式会查找A列中的每个值,并根据匹配结果生成对应的关系。
二、数据验证生成与户主关系
数据验证功能可以帮助我们确保输入的数据符合预期,并且可以用来生成与户主的关系。
1、设置数据验证
通过数据验证,用户可以在输入数据时选择预定义的选项,从而减少错误输入。例如,我们可以设置一个下拉菜单,让用户选择“户主”或“家庭成员”。
- 选择要应用数据验证的单元格。
- 点击“数据”选项卡,然后选择“数据验证”。
- 在“允许”下拉菜单中选择“序列”,并在“来源”框中输入“户主,家庭成员”。
2、使用数据验证结合公式
我们还可以结合数据验证和公式来生成与户主的关系。例如,假设我们有一个列包含所有家庭成员的姓名和一个列包含户主的姓名,我们可以通过数据验证来选择关系,并通过公式自动生成结果。
三、使用数据透视表生成与户主关系
数据透视表是Excel中一个强大的工具,可以帮助我们快速生成与户主的关系。
1、创建数据透视表
- 选择包含数据的单元格区域。
- 点击“插入”选项卡,然后选择“数据透视表”。
- 在弹出的窗口中选择数据透视表的位置(可以选择新工作表或现有工作表)。
2、配置数据透视表
- 将家庭成员姓名拖到“行标签”区域。
- 将户主姓名拖到“值”区域。
- 配置数据透视表以显示与户主的关系。
数据透视表可以帮助我们快速汇总和分析数据,生成与户主关系的结果。
四、使用自定义函数生成与户主关系
Excel还允许我们编写自定义函数来生成与户主的关系。这需要使用VBA(Visual Basic for Applications)编程。
1、编写自定义函数
- 按Alt + F11打开VBA编辑器。
- 点击“插入”菜单,然后选择“模块”。
- 在模块窗口中输入以下代码:
Function GetRelationship(member As String, head As String) As String
If member = head Then
GetRelationship = "户主"
Else
GetRelationship = "家庭成员"
End If
End Function
- 保存并关闭VBA编辑器。
2、使用自定义函数
在Excel中,我们可以像使用其他函数一样使用自定义函数。例如,如果A列是家庭成员姓名,B列是户主姓名,我们可以在C列使用以下公式:
=GetRelationship(A2, B2)
五、使用宏生成与户主关系
宏是另一个强大的工具,可以帮助我们自动化生成与户主的关系。宏可以记录一系列操作,并在需要时运行这些操作。
1、录制宏
- 点击“开发工具”选项卡,然后选择“录制宏”。
- 在弹出的窗口中输入宏的名称,然后点击“确定”。
- 执行生成与户主关系所需的操作。
- 完成后点击“开发工具”选项卡,然后选择“停止录制”。
2、运行宏
- 点击“开发工具”选项卡,然后选择“宏”。
- 选择刚才录制的宏,然后点击“运行”。
宏可以帮助我们快速重复执行复杂的操作,从而提高工作效率。
六、总结
在Excel中生成与户主关系的方法多种多样,包括使用公式、数据验证、VLOOKUP函数、数据透视表、自定义函数和宏等。每种方法都有其独特的优势和适用场景。通过合理使用这些工具,我们可以高效地生成与户主的关系,并提高工作效率。
对于大多数用户来说,使用IF公式和VLOOKUP函数是最简单且直观的方法,而对于高级用户,数据透视表和自定义函数则提供了更强大的功能和灵活性。无论选择哪种方法,都需要根据具体需求和数据情况进行选择。希望本篇文章能为您提供有价值的参考,帮助您在Excel中更高效地生成与户主的关系。
相关问答FAQs:
Q: Excel中如何生成与户主关系?
A: 在Excel中生成与户主关系,您可以按照以下步骤进行操作:
-
如何在Excel中创建与户主关系的列?
在Excel表格中,选择一个空白列,例如列C,将其命名为“与户主关系”。这将是您记录与户主关系的列。
-
如何输入与户主关系的数据?
在“与户主关系”列中,逐行输入每个人与户主的关系。例如,您可以输入“子女”、“配偶”、“父母”等与户主关系。
-
如何使用Excel的数据验证功能确保数据的准确性?
可以使用Excel的数据验证功能来确保您输入的与户主关系是有效的。在“与户主关系”列的单元格中,选择“数据”选项卡,然后点击“数据验证”。在弹出的对话框中,选择“列表”作为验证条件,然后在“来源”框中输入您想要的与户主关系选项,点击“确定”。
-
如何使用Excel的筛选功能根据户主关系进行筛选?
如果您想根据与户主关系筛选数据,可以使用Excel的筛选功能。在Excel表格的标题行上,点击“数据”选项卡中的“筛选”按钮。然后,在“与户主关系”列的筛选箭头下拉菜单中选择您想要筛选的与户主关系选项。
希望以上解答对您有所帮助,如果您有其他问题,请随时提问。
文章包含AI辅助创作,作者:Edit1,如若转载,请注明出处:https://docs.pingcode.com/baike/4427198